Nicki Minaj has shared the reasons behind her embrace of MAGA politics, citing frustrations with former president Barack Obama and his friendship with rapper Jay-Z as a catalyst for her increasingly right-wing views.
The Trinidadian rapper, 43, who publicly declared herself Donald Trump’s “number one fan” in January, has said she’s leaned more conservative for a while.
In a wide-ranging interview with Time magazine, Minaj shared the root of her political conversion. She explained that during Obama’s time in office, there seemed to be an unspoken expectation that Black entertainers would automatically support the Democratic Party.
Adding to the “Starships” artist’s disapproval of Obama was his friendship with Jay-Z, with whom Minaj has a long-standing rivalry over allegations that he tried to sabotage her career through his entertainment company Roc Nation’s power monopoly in the industry.
“Jay-Z ended up costing Obama a lot, whether he knows it or not,” Minaj said, claiming, “Lots of rappers don’t like Jay-Z and were afraid to say it.”

Minaj further referenced a 2024 speech Obama delivered on the campaign trail for Kamala Harris, in which he suggested that some Black male voters were uncomfortable with the idea of putting a woman in power.
“I just saw so many videos of Black men saying that they didn’t like the way they felt about that speech that Obama gave,” the Grammy-winning artist said. “They felt like they weren’t being listened to.”
Elsewhere in the interview, she revealed that she had felt pro-Trump for some time, but “didn’t dare act like that publicly” for fear of alienating fans. “It’s been ingrained in everyone’s brain in the music business that we are supposed to be a Democratic family,” she said. “I just knew they would not like me supporting Trump.”
However, since coming out in full support of Trump’s agenda, Minaj said she’s “never felt happier.”

“I’ve never felt better,” she added. “When you can be yourself, you’re happier.”
Minaj’s outspoken support for the president in recent months has surprised many of her fans. She previously addressed the reason behind her backing of Trump on an episode of The Katie Miller Podcast in February.
“When I saw how he was being treated over and over and over, I just couldn’t handle it,” she said. “I felt that…a lot of that bullying, and the smear campaigns and all of the lying, I felt that that had been done to me for so many years.
“And I was watching it in real time happen to someone else, and I didn’t think he deserved it,” Minaj argued.
